Wall Street is trading higher again today, pushing towards record levels. The S&P500 is within 1% of its record high. Overall, the bull market that we are in is about to become the longest bull market in history. Its start goes back to the first quarter of 2009, where the stock market was 20% higher than the bottom set from the financial crisis of 2008. As long as we do not drop 20% below the highs, it is considered a running bull market. A bear market is when the market drops 20% from its highs, and investorsdo not even have that term in their mind at the moment.
